THRACO-MACEDONIAN TRIBES, Bisaltai. Mosses. Circa 475-465 BC. AR Drachm (15mm, 3.03 g, 12h). Horseman, wearing petasos and holding two spears, standing right beside his horse standing right in foreground; uncertain symbol to upper left / MO-Σ-Σ-E-Ω in shallow incuse square, around quadripartite square in relief. Peykov C0100; HPM pl. XI, 20 = Traité pl. XLVI, 21; HGC 3, 276. Toned, edge split, flan flaw on obverse. VF. Rare.

From the collection of a Northern California Gentleman, purchased from Frank Kovacs, September 1999. Lot also includes an old Spink inventory ticket.
